About the Role

We are hiring a Director, Finance Systems Enablement to own the design and optimization of Finance & Accounting systems with a core focus on Oracle NetSuite within our operational accounting technology environment.

This role sits within Accounting and Reporting and reports to the Senior Director, Accounting Systems. You will serve as the hands-on system expert responsible for maintaining, enhancing, and continuously improving NetSuite in support of key operational accounting processes, including procure-to-pay, record-to-report, intercompany, and close activities. You’ll work closely with Accounting, the master data team, IT, and other system stakeholders to translate accounting requirements into effective system configurations, workflows, reporting, roles, permissions, and automation.

This is a critical role for ensuring the ongoing health, performance, optimisation, and control integrity of NetSuite itself. Your work will directly improve system reliability, strengthen controls, reduce manual effort, and help accounting teams operate with greater accuracy and visibility as Nscale continues to scale.
